Background info. from Military Times,
Marine Sgt. John Winnick II: Sniper charged in deaths of Iraqi civilians
The charges allege Winnick killed the civilians on June 17, 2007, during combat operations near Lake Tharthar in Anbar, Iraq.
The charges also allege he fired at two others without first identifying whether any of the civilians posed a threat, Myers said.
Another Rules of Engagement situation, during combat, where family members have to spend the big bucks to defend their son's honor while looking at (in this case) 40 years, plus a dishnorable discharge.
